Output edfd5cf5a36c74d810a3cc0f63b6b63469f38d876b2e2a21f4259c4132243f10:1

value
315988264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37a5a895300d134de9a97ebbba1a212892fc1dc6 OP_EQUALVERIFY OP_CHECKSIG
address
165EchzvuksTRGSRisrKb1zjWesVxE2dT5
transaction
edfd5cf5a36c74d810a3cc0f63b6b63469f38d876b2e2a21f4259c4132243f10
spent
true